Influence of Sleep on Metabolism



When it comes to weight-loss, understanding the effect of sleep on metabolic process is crucial. Rest plays a significant function in controling your body's metabolic process, which is the process of converting food into power. During rest, your body works on repairing tissues, manufacturing hormones, and controling various physical functions. Lack of sleep can interfere with these processes, resulting in discrepancies in metabolic process.

Duty of Sleep in Hormonal Agent Regulation



As you dig deeper right into the link between rest and fat burning, it ends up being evident that the duty of sleep in hormonal agent guideline is a vital factor to take into consideration. Sleep plays a critical function in the policy of various hormones that influence hunger and metabolism. One essential hormone impacted by rest is leptin, which helps control energy balance by inhibiting hunger. Lack of sleep can lead to lower degrees of leptin, making you really feel hungrier and potentially resulting in over-eating.

Moreover, not enough rest can impact insulin sensitivity, which is critical for regulating blood glucose levels. Poor rest practices can cause insulin resistance, raising the danger of weight gain and type 2 diabetic issues.

Impact of Sleep on Food Cravings



Rest plays a considerable function in affecting your food desires. As a result, you might find yourself yearning high-calorie and sugary foods to offer a fast energy boost.

Furthermore, lack of sleep can influence the mind's benefit centers, making unhealthy foods much more enticing and harder to withstand.

Study has shown that sleep-deprived people tend to choose foods that are higher in fat and calories contrasted to when they're well-rested. This can sabotage your weight reduction efforts and result in unwanted weight gain with time.
